問題タブ [overflow-menu]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- Androidでスライドメニューとオーバーフローメニューを一緒に実装する方法
私はAndroidが初めてで、Android 2.2+でスライドメニュー(ナビゲーションドロワー)とオーバーフローメニューを一緒に実装したいと考えています。両方を一緒に実装するにはどうすればよいですか?
android - TextView CustomActionModeCallback でオーバーフロー メニュー項目を選択する
テキストビューを長押ししながら、カスタム アクション バーを表示しようとしています。メニューに 5 つ以上の項目があり、一部の項目がオーバーフロー メニューの下に表示されます。
オーバーフロー アイコンを押すと、アクション バーが破棄され、オーバーフロー内の項目を選択できません。
android - アクションバーのオーバーフロー メニューの開閉リスナー
ユーザーが ActionBar のオーバーフロー メニュー (3 つのドット) を開いたり閉じたりしたときに、次のようにリッスンしたい:
未解決のケースを処理するために を試しましonPrepareOptionsMenu()
たが、ActionBar が構築されたとき、またはinvalidateOptionsMenu()
が呼び出されたときにトリガーされます。これは私が望むものではありません。
ユーザーが でメニュー項目を選択すると、オーバーフロー メニューが閉じていることを検出できましたonMenuItemSelected()
。しかし、ユーザーがオーバーフローメニューの外側をタップしたり、戻るキーを押したり、その他すべての場合に閉じたりした場合も、それを検出したいと考えています。
それを実装する方法はありますか?
android - メニュー ボタンを押すたびに onMenuOpened/onPanelClosed の二重コールバック
Android アプリで、オーバーフロー (3 つのドット) アクション バー メニューがいつ (どのくらいの頻度で) 開閉されたか (項目が選択されていない状態) に関する統計を収集したいと考えています。このタスクでは、 と 内のメソッドをオーバーライドonMenuOpened
しonPanelClosed
ましたActivity
。ただし、すべてのデバイス (Android 4.4、4.2、Samsung および HTC) でこれを試してみましたが、これらのメソッドは、メニューが開いたり閉じたりするたびに 2 回トリガーされます。これはバグですか?このメニューの開閉を監視する別の方法はありますか?
android - オーバーフロー メニューにオプションを追加する
アクションバーのオーバーフロー メニューに 2 番目の項目が追加されない理由を誰かが説明できますか? 設定は正しく表示され、 を に設定するとプロファイルが表示されますが、オーバーフロー メニューにプロファイルが表示されるようにしたいと考えています。showAsAction
always
android - アクションバーのアイテムがオーバーフローメニューにあるか、実際にアクションバーに表示されているかを検出しますか?
これはアクションバーの私の項目の 1 つです -
ここでは、 showAsAction で ifRoom を使用しています。利用可能なスペースに応じて、アクションバーに表示される場合と表示されない場合があります。オーバーフロー メニューに表示されているか、実際にアクション バーに表示されているかを検出するにはどうすればよいですか? (私は ActionBarSherlock を使用していません)
android - オーバーフロー メニューの 3 ドットを削除するには?
理解を助けてください。android:targetSdkVersion="14 を設定すると、これらの 3 つのドットが表示されなくなります。
これらの 3 つのドットがまだ表示されるのはなぜですか?
私が別の活動から戻るまで、彼らは現れません。別のアクティビティから戻ってメニューキーを押すと、彼らが現れました....
私はアクションバー メニューを使用しているので、アプリにこれらの醜い 3 ドットは必要ありません。
それらを完全に削除するにはどうすればよいですか?
ありがとう
マニフェスト:
主な活動:
android - Android - ActionBar - オーバーフロー メニューを非表示にしますか?
このオーバーフロー メニューを非表示にしたい: 忙しい猫 http://cdn.intertech.com/PostingImages/Android-Action-Bar-from-the-Options-Menu_E1C5/image_7.png
targetSdkVersion="14" を設定すると非表示にできます。しかし、私はそれを望んでいません。ターゲットバージョンを提供したくありません。
ここでもこれを試しました(/res/values/styles.xml):
動作していません。3 つの点のメニューが表示されます。